For those who have been- what tube station do we need to use, and can we eat somewhere beforehand? What sort of food is available? Thanks, going on thursday but the whole day is pretty rammed so need to have a proper itineray!
you need north greenwich tube station on the jubilee line and yes i would suggest you eat before the show.
there are places like zizzi and frankie and bennys as well as chinese, sushi, mexican etc - there is alot of choice
hope you enjoy the show!!
